GHOSTBUSTERS to start filming in 2015 without Ivan Reitman

So it looks like Ghostbusters is happening after all.  So what's the catch??  We're not getting Ivan Reitman and it's a reboot.  Here's what Reitman had to say about his departure:

“When I came back from Harold’s funeral, it was really moving and it made me think about a lot of things. I’d just finished directing Draft Day, which I’m really happy with and proud of. Working on a film that is smaller and more dramatic was so much fun and satisfying. I just finally met with Amy and Doug Belgrad when I got back. I said I’d been thinking about it for weeks, that I’d rather just produce this Ghostbusters. I told them I thought I could help but let’s find a really good director and make it with him. So that’s what we've agreed will happen. I didn’t want all kinds of speculation about what happened with me, that is the real story.”

With that in mind, is a reboot really necessary or should we see the remaining 3 in Ghostbusters 3??  I think that if they go ahead and film this, we (the fans) should have a part in picking the new Ghostbusters.  This way if it fails, we'd have no one to blame but ourselves.
